Acute respiratory failure in severe hematologic disorders

Summary
Intensive therapy for acute respiratory failure in hematologic disorders showed poor outcomes. Most patients required mechanical ventilation, and survival rates were very low, highlighting challenges in managing these critical conditions.

Background:
- Acute respiratory failure (ARF) poses a severe threat to patients with hematologic disorders (HDs).
- These patients often exhibit poor response to conventional intensive therapies.
Purpose of the Study:
- To evaluate the effectiveness of intensive therapy in patients with hematologic disorders experiencing ARF.
- To analyze diagnostic methods and outcomes in this high-risk patient group.
Main Methods:
- Retrospective analysis of 30 patients with leukemia, bone-marrow aplasia, or lymphoma admitted to an intensive respiratory unit.
- Inclusion of patients receiving mechanical ventilation or continuous positive airway pressure (CPAP).
- Assessment of diagnostic accuracy for serology and transbronchial biopsy.
Main Results:
- All 30 patients presented with hypoxemia and poor response to high-concentration oxygen.
- Mechanical ventilation was required for 26 patients; 4 received CPAP.
- Only 6 patients (20%) recovered from ARF, with just 2 discharged; 80% of patients died in the unit.
Conclusions:
- Intensive therapy for ARF in hematologic disorders has a dismal prognosis.
- Diagnostic methods like serology and transbronchial biopsy showed limited accuracy.
- High mortality rates underscore the need for improved management strategies for ARF in HDs.
